Xbox continues to strengthen its global strategy and has set its sights on one of the largest and most complex markets in the world: China. According to a job posting on Microsoft’s official portal, the company is looking to hire a China Business Development Lead, a position designed to expand partnerships with game publishers and developers in the region.
The mission of this new role will be to negotiate strategic agreements with studios, both large and independent, and ensure that Microsoft’s platforms (including: Xbox Series, PC, Game Pass, and Cloud Gaming) become priority destinations for game development and publication in Asia.
China: a key part of Xbox’s global strategy
The position will be based in Shanghai, Beijing, or Shenzhen, and will involve international and local travel to consolidate relationships with industry partners. Among its responsibilities are:
-
Establishing and expanding agreements with Chinese publishers and studios.
-
Driving the ID@Xbox initiative, supporting independent developers.
-
Negotiating contracts that include releases on Xbox, Windows, Xbox Game Pass, and associated events.
-
Analyzing market opportunities in China and worldwide for new gaming-related business lines.
-
Coordinating the execution of Microsoft’s strategies in collaboration with teams from Asia, Europe, and the Americas.
This move shows Microsoft’s intention to improve and position Game Pass and its services in a market that represents millions of potential players. The reinforced presence in China may also open the door to collaborations with local studios that have grown in prestige and international reach in recent years.
